// ProgressMt.h
#include "StdAfx.h"
#include "ProgressMt.h"
void CMtCompressProgressMixer::Init(unsigned numItems, ICompressProgressInfo *progress)
{
NWindows::NSynchronization::CCriticalSectionLock lock(CriticalSection);
InSizes.Clear();
OutSizes.Clear();
for (unsigned i = 0; i < numItems; i++)
{
InSizes.Add(0);
OutSizes.Add(0);
}
TotalInSize = 0;
TotalOutSize = 0;
_progress = progress;
}
void CMtCompressProgressMixer::Reinit(unsigned index)
{
NWindows::NSynchronization::CCriticalSectionLock lock(CriticalSection);
InSizes[index] = 0;
OutSizes[index] = 0;
}
HRESULT CMtCompressProgressMixer::SetRatioInfo(unsigned index, const UInt64 *inSize, const UInt64 *outSize)
{
NWindows::NSynchronization::CCriticalSectionLock lock(CriticalSection);
if (inSize)
{
const UInt64 diff = *inSize - InSizes[index];
InSizes[index] = *inSize;
TotalInSize += diff;
}
if (outSize)
{
const UInt64 diff = *outSize - OutSizes[index];
OutSizes[index] = *outSize;
TotalOutSize += diff;
}
if (_progress)
return _progress->SetRatioInfo(&TotalInSize, &TotalOutSize);
return S_OK;
}
Z7_COM7F_IMF(CMtCompressProgress::SetRatioInfo(const UInt64 *inSize, const UInt64 *outSize))
{
return _progress->SetRatioInfo(_index, inSize, outSize);
}
